Recently I've been reading a book called Linked: How everything is connected to everything else and what it means, by Albert-Laszlo Barabasi.
Barabasi says that -- scientifically speaking --everything we thought we knew about networks is wrong.
How do we know? The internet is the first real man-made network that functions like an organic one. It's possible to study it because every aspect of it can be quantified and measured, and all its functions are known.
Exploration and analysis of the Internet has overturned many network theories of which, admittedly, I knew nothing. I won't go into them in detail here, but I highly recommend you buy the book. Barabasi's writing style is highly entertaining and readable, and the story fascinating.
The book ranges from six degrees of separation to Hollywood to cellular dynamics and why we haven't cured cancer yet. It talks about the long tail, the 80/20 rule, social networking and many other topics of interest to the Web 2.0 crowd.
One of the most interesting things to me is how wrong we were, and how little the subject had actually been explored until recently.

I too thought the Barabasi book was excellent. I would recommend you take a look at Nexus: Small Worlds and the Groundbreaking Theory of Networks by Mark Buchanan. The Barabasi book makes you feel that he invented the whole area. Buchanans book is equally accessible but takes a broader look at the area and puts Barabasi's work in its rightful place.
